Greens leader Adam Bandt set to lose his seat of Melbourne

Andrew Tillett

The Greens will likely need a new leader with senators Sarah Hanson-Young and Mehreen Faruqi the favourites to battle it out in the shrunken party room after leader Adam Bandt was projected to lose his seat.

Bandt suffered a shock 8.3 per cent swing against him on election day and became the minor party’s latest casualty after two seats were lost in Brisbane and potential gains in Melbourne and northern NSW failed to materialise.
